“This dish can be made with cooked meat. In this case cook for 25 minutes only.”
Ingredients:
700 g minced beef 1 thick slice bread (about 110 g) 275 ml milk 2 onions, sliced 2 small eggs 2 teaspoons Screaming Seeds ‘Outback Blend’ 2 teaspoons sugar 1 teaspoon salt 1 teaspoon vinegar or lemon juice 1 tablespoon olive oil a few almonds, chopped
Method:
Put bread into a dish, pour over the milk and let stand for 15 minutes. Then pour off and keep any milk that has not been absorbed
Heat the oil in a frying pan and cook the onions until soft. Then add the Screaming Seeds ‘Outback Blend’, sugar, salt, vinegar or lemon juice and mix thoroughly
Beat the bread until very soft then add to the fried onion mixture together with the meat, almonds and one of the eggs
Place the mixture into the bottom of a well-greased oven dish
Beat the second egg, add the milk reserved from soaking the bread and pour over the meat
Cook for 30 minutes in the middle of a moderately hot oven (200°C). Reduce the heat to 180°C and cook for a further 30 minutes
